"The Nation's Favorite Elvis Songs" Documentary To Debut in the United Kingdom November 8th
October 23, 2013
Elvis fans in the United Kingdom will have the opportunity to vote for their favorite Elvis song with a countdown show dedicated to the king. "The Nation's Favourite Elvis Songs" will debut on November 8 on ITV in the United Kingdom. Elvis fans can now check out the featured top 20 songs (not in order of appearance) on a new playlist in Amazon and iTunes!
This 90-minute special tells the story behind the 20 greatest songs ever recorded by Elvis Presley, the King of Rock ‘n’ Roll. All of the songs from the programme will be featured on a brand new compilation album from Sony Music, "The Nation’s Favourite Elvis Songs," which will be released on November 4, prior to the show.
Mixing rich archive footage and home videos with new interviews, the documentary paints a picture of the man behind the music, telling the story of how these timeless songs came about and what impact they had on the world. The show features different generations of international pop stars and musicians influenced by Elvis including Michael Bublé, Sir Cliff Richard, Suzi Quatro, Michael Ball, Englebert Humperdink and Cerys Matthews.
The programme also hears from those who worked with Elvis, from songwriters to backing singers and session musicians, plus a special interview with Priscilla Presley. The documentary ventures into Elvis’ former home in Memphis, Graceland, following in the footsteps of nearly 20 million visitors, to see how popular the king remains to this day.
